The biggest producers are China, Australia, Russia, and the United States. Most gold comes from large, commercial mines, though 15 to 20 percent of the world's gold comes from small-scale or artisanal mines, largely in Africa, Asia, and Latin America. Jewelry represent over half of the globe's gold need, an estimated 1,600 bunches of gold for 2016.


(copyright), and Kinross Gold Company (copyright). Gold from industrial mines might be exported straight to refiners, while artisanal gold might pass from one trader to another prior to being exported for refining.


Jewelry business might source their gold straight from refiners, or from makers, banks, or international gold investors. China and India are the biggest markets for gold fashion jewelry, representing over 50 percent of global precious jewelry demand. Around the globe, countless people function in gold and diamond mining. The large bulk of theman approximated 40 million peoplework in artisanal and small-scale mines, which operate with little or no machinery and frequently come from the informal industry.


Industrial mining operations are additionally significant employers; around one million individuals function in industrial gold mining operations. Nonetheless, mining has additionally added to human legal rights misuses. Civils Rights See and various other civil culture groups have actually recorded a variety of human civil liberties misuses in the context of gold and ruby mining, consisting of labor civil liberties abuses, conflict-related misuses versus private citizens, violations of the right to environmental health, and other violations.

These restrictions are clearly mirrored in the residential legislations of numerous countries where hazardous kid labor nonetheless remains to linger. Kids who work in mining are commonly subjected to extreme threat. Lots of kids operate in deep, unpredictable pits; some have been injured or also killed in accidents. Kids experience respiratory condition from breathing in dust, discomfort and back injury from the lifting of hefty rocks, and various other health and wellness conditions from mining.




Civil Rights Watch has documented making use of dangerous child labor in gold or ruby mining in Ghana, Mali, Nigeria, the Philippines, Tanzania, and Zimbabwe. Tissot Watches. Various other independent investigations have documented harmful youngster labor in golden goose in Burkina Faso, Uganda, the Autonomous Republic of Congo, and Indonesia. In some gold and ruby mines, grownups and youngsters have ended up being sufferers of required labor and human trafficking


Human trafficking happens when an individual is hired or transported by force, threat, or deceptiveness for the objective of exploitation. Human being Civil liberty Watch found that in Eritrea, for example, conscripts for the national service program were required to work indefinitely for a subcontractor of a Canadian gold mining company. Workers have started a lawsuit against the company.

Other researches have documented required labor in cash cow in Peru and the Democratic Republic of Congo. Gold and ruby mining procedures have occasionally caused significant ecological damages and endangered individuals's civil liberties to wellness, water, food, and a healthy and balanced setting. Large-scale commercial mines have actually triggered hazardous contamination through the unloading of tailings (mine residue), leaks, and mishaps.




In some situations, worldwide mining business and governments have actually abused the legal rights of local homeowners when clearing land for exploration and mining. In Zimbabwe, as an example, the federal government has been charged of by force displacing citizens to give way for ruby mining in Marange (moissanite rings). Mining operations have actually also created offenses of the legal rights of aboriginal peoples


Amnesty International reported that the Mount Polley mining disaster in copyright adversely impacted the conventional livelihood of native peoplessalmon fishingand damaged sacred lands and traditional medicines. When aboriginal people in some nations have objected against mining procedures, they have actually often encountered suppression and even been killed. Gold and ruby companies have actually also been straight connected to violations of global humanitarian legislation, which relates to situations of armed problem.

Firms have human rights duties. These responsibilities have been defined in the More hints United Nations Guiding Concepts on Service and Human Rights, a global requirement that was recommended by the UN Civil Rights Council in 2011 and has given that been widely identified by firms. Under the Guiding Principles, business are anticipated to take aggressive steps to ensure that they do not trigger or add to human civil liberties abuses within their worldwide procedures, and react to civils rights misuses when they occur.




The Guiding Principles need firms to implemented civils rights due diligencethat is, a procedure to recognize, prevent, alleviate, and account for companies' influence on human rightsthroughout their supply chain - Citizen Watches. Businesses ought to monitor their human civil liberties effect on a continuous basis and have procedures in position to remediate damaging civils rights effects they trigger or to which they contribute


The European Union has actually passed a Minerals Regulation that will participate in force from 2021. It will oblige companies importing gold, tin, tungsten, and tantalum right into the European Union to conduct due diligence to make sure that they are not adding to conflict-related abuses or other offenses. One of the most commonly accepted standard in the priceless minerals sector is the OECD's "Due Persistance Advice for Liable Supply Chains of Minerals from Conflict-Affected and High-Risk Locations."
